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
803 23 786587228 95837670999 1638092029
2059 703129
2059 703129
0912 31 335770
All about undefined
Interested in learning more?
2059 703129
0912 31 335770
See more
349 71908828
10021162070 263 4946 614497
See more
240370916 8691
936378 45 58753882531 885873625 89
See more